Title: Producing pure water for trollys
Post by: th77 on April 21, 2010, 07:00:29 pm
I will be starting  window cleaning shortly using wfp. I was wondering how you produce pure water and where do you store it,if you are using a trolly system?
presumably it is already pure when in containers and on trolly ready to use.
Ps
I am in a hard water area.

Thanks.
Title: Re: Producing pure water for trollys
Post by: richywilts on April 21, 2010, 08:13:49 pm
best looking at buying a static system if you have a garage or somewhere like a decent shed to store water in an ibc tank (1000litre) you can build ya own static system but as you seem a bit of a novice it maybe best to buy one in they can be quite costly up to 2grand though, if there are any other window cleaners from your area who have a system im sure theyd be happy to help you setup a system diy
